KITCHEN SHIFT SUPERVISOR
A multifaceted role, the Kitchen Shift Supervisor works in conjunction with the General Manager to oversee the daily operations of the restaurant. Focusing on staff training, generation of top line revenue and management of labour and cost of goods, the Shift Supervisor will be involved in all aspects of the restaurant.
WHAT'S ON YOUR PLATE:
Champion the brand’s vision and values and ensures alignment amongst the concept team
Support a culture of positivity and high standards where all staff CHASE perfection in everything they do
Lead by example, create an environment that is warm, welcoming and filled with positivity for guests and employees
Executes standard operating procedures, coordinates restaurant operations during each shift, determines and implements operating improvements
Supporting Leadership Team in developing and implementing creative and effective staff training initiatives
Executing efficient operations and keeping guests satisfied and coming back to build sales
Assist in creating department schedules as per business levels to ensure budgeted labour costs are met
Assist in ordering food, beverages, and supplies to ensure all items are in-stock
Monitors adherence to health, safety and hygiene standards within location, ensure compliance with restaurant security procedures, inclusive of alcohol regulations, ensure a safe working environment by facilitating safe work behaviors of the team and guests, maintains safe, secure, and healthy facility environment by establishing, following, and enforcing sanitation standards and procedures; complying with health and legal regulations; maintaining security systems
Maintains restaurant cleanliness and upholds esthetics standards of CHG
Monitor inventory reports and order when necessary
Resolving in-service guest complaints
Identifying and following up on tasks related to repairs, cleaning and maintenance to ensure restaurant cleanliness standards are always met
Attendance and contribution to Banquet Event Order (BEO) and Operations Team meetings
INGREDIENTS YOU WILL BRING TO THE TABLE:
2+ years in a Supervisory role with high volume exposure in a full-service restaurant
Experience with sales projections, expense budgets, analyzing profit and loss statements
Focused on building and promoting the company’s vision and values
Ability to learn and bring "out of the box" ideas to the team
Self-starter with the ability to motivate and recognize all levels of staff
Genuine enthusiasm and aptitude for serving people to ensure WOW factor
Excellent verbal and written communication skills
High level of business acumen
Demonstrates strong problem solving skills through ability to diagnose and implement solutions

The CHG-MERIDIAN Group is a leading global technology leasing company in the IT, industrial, and healthcare sectors.
With over 1,600 employees worldwide we develop, finance, and manage customized technology, finance solutions based on circular economy principals. This gives customers including large corporations, public sector organizations, and hospitals access to the latest technologies, cost-effective financing models, and tailored services that meet individual needs.
CHG-MERIDIAN currently manages a technology portfolio worth over $13 billion USD (2024) and has a presence in 32 countries on five continents without being tied to any specific banks or manufacturers. Our services are available in up to 190 countries through subsidiaries, partner networks, and affiliated companies. Using a circular tech approach, CHG-MERIDIAN manages our customers’ equipment assets along the entire lifecycle, from procurement to remarketing.
